Subject: Pilot Churn — Action Needed

Sales leads,

Churn in the Glimmerpath pilot hit 14% last month, double forecast. Exit interviews cite onboarding friction, not price. Tobin's team ships fixes Friday. Pause new pilot enrolments until then. Weekly churn reports start Monday. Context on where this fits in our plans is in the confidential note below.

— Rhea Castellan

internal memo for kawip-hadug: Headcount on the Wenwyn team goes from 7 to 140 by the end of January. Gross margin on Wenwyn came in at 20 percent against a plan of 15 percent.

// Heads up, reviewer: this constant sets how often Chattervane, our
// deploy-status bot, polls the Pellworth pipeline API. We tried 5s and
// got rate-limited into oblivion; 30s felt sluggish during incident
// calls. 12s is the compromise everyone grudgingly accepted. If you
// change it, update the runbook too. The bot build this was tuned
// against is identified by the token below.

build token for kagaf-hahof: htk14_9d3d4d26d7d8de

MEMO — Regional Sales Review, Southreach Territory

To all sales leads: the Southreach review concluded Friday. Bookings landed 3% below plan; renewals on the Calder suite outperformed, new logos underperformed. Pipeline coverage for next quarter sits at 2.1x, below our 2.5x standard. Leads should submit updated forecasts by Wednesday. Planned corrective measures are outlined in the confidential note below.

management briefing: Project Ulavan slips by two quarters because of the staffing delay.

Ticket #4471 — ChipGate reader failing at Lindmoor Marathon staging

The trackside ChipGate reader at the Lindmoor course keeps rejecting uploads to the Pacerly results service. Root cause: the env file on the reader unit was copied from the demo rig, so it points at the sandbox endpoint. Fix: set PACERLY_ENV=production and PACERLY_UPLOAD_TIMEOUT=30 in /opt/chipgate/.env. Uploads also authenticate with a device credential that the demo copy lacked, so append this line to the same file.

vault entry, yahif-yajep: COURIER_KEY29=b802bdf8034096b65a51c6ba5abe2